Following the turmoil of the global financial crisis last year, Standard Chartered Bank has launched a new worldwide brand platform and its first global positioning campaign in 40 years.

Standard Chartered | Here for Good | Regional
Featuring the tag ‘Here for good’, the brand drive, which took seven-months to develop, aims to communicate the bank’s values and resonance with customers, clients and staff across its global footprint.

On the premise of the campaign, Peter Sands, Standard Chartered’s group chief executive, said: “The brand is all about commitment. We’re here for good, to create value for our shareholders, to support and partner our clients and customers and to make a positive contribution to the broader community. This is the way we do business: it has underpinned our strategy and success for over 150 years and it will be the foundation for our future.”

Developed by global creative partner TBWA, ‘Here for good’ will run in television, print, digital and outdoor media channels. Philip Brett, TBWA’s group president for South and Southeast Asia, says the work is not just a traditional positioning but an “articulation” of what the international bank has been doing in its operations.

The communications also seeks to differentiate the Standard Chartered brand from its competitors in a jaded category that has seen institutions taking a beating over the past 18 months. Global media duties for the new campaign will be handled by OMD.

The campaign’s four television spots were directed by African artist Ezra Wube, Chinese filmmaker Tian Zhuang Zhuang, Jordanian documentary producer Sandra Madi, and internationally acclaimed graphic designer Stefan Sagmeister. The print drive features 25 different executions to cater to local market sentiments.
